Effective Ways To Shield Your Iphone 15 Pro Max From Cold Weather Damage

As winter sets in, millions of iPhone users face a silent threat: cold weather. While the iPhone 15 Pro Max is engineered with advanced materials and robust thermal management, extreme cold can still compromise its functionality, battery life, and long-term durability. Unlike heat damage, which often triggers immediate warnings, cold-related issues creep in subtly—reduced responsiveness, sudden shutdowns, or even screen discoloration. Understanding how low temperatures affect your device and taking proactive steps can prevent costly repairs and extend your phone’s lifespan.

The iPhone 15 Pro Max operates best between 0°C and 35°C (32°F to 95°F), according to Apple’s official guidelines. Once temperatures drop below this range, especially below freezing, internal components begin to react unpredictably. Lithium-ion batteries lose efficiency rapidly in the cold, screens may flicker or dim, and moisture condensation upon re-entry to warm environments can cause internal corrosion. But with informed habits and practical precautions, you can keep your iPhone resilient—even in subzero climates.

How Cold Weather Affects Your iPhone 15 Pro Max

The iPhone 15 Pro Max uses a lithium-ion battery, which is highly sensitive to temperature fluctuations. In cold environments, chemical reactions within the battery slow down, reducing its ability to deliver power efficiently. This results in rapid battery drain or unexpected shutdowns—even when the battery shows 20% or more charge. The OLED display is also vulnerable; cold temperatures increase pixel response time, leading to ghosting, lag, or temporary color shifts.

Additionally, thermal stress from moving between extreme cold and warmth causes microscopic expansion and contraction of internal components. Over time, this can weaken solder joints and connections. Condensation is another hidden risk: bringing a frozen phone into a heated room leads to moisture buildup inside the casing, potentially short-circuiting sensitive electronics.

Practical Strategies to Protect Your iPhone in Winter

Shielding your iPhone 15 Pro Max from cold doesn’t require expensive gear—just consistent awareness and smart habits. Here are proven methods to minimize cold-induced stress:

1. Use a Thermal-Insulated Case

Standard silicone or clear cases offer minimal insulation. Instead, opt for rugged cases designed with thermal linings or neoprene sleeves. These create a microclimate around the phone, slowing heat loss. Brands like Lifeproof and OtterBox offer models that combine drop protection with enhanced thermal resistance.

Tip: Carry your phone close to your body—inside a jacket pocket rather than an outer bag—to leverage body heat as natural insulation.

2. Minimize Outdoor Screen Usage

Operating the touchscreen in freezing conditions increases strain on both the display and battery. Limit interactions to essentials. If navigation is needed, pre-load maps and use voice-guided directions without unlocking the phone frequently.

3. Avoid Charging in Cold Environments

Charging a cold iPhone accelerates battery wear. Lithium-ion cells should be near room temperature before connecting to power. Charging below 0°C can cause lithium plating, a condition that permanently reduces capacity and increases failure risk.

4. Warm Up Gradually After Cold Exposure

If your iPhone has been exposed to extreme cold, do not immediately place it near heaters or blow dryers. Rapid temperature shifts promote condensation. Instead, let it acclimate slowly in a cool, dry room for 30–60 minutes before use or charging.

Step-by-Step Guide: Safely Using Your iPhone in Subzero Conditions

Follow this timeline when anticipating prolonged cold exposure:

  1. Before Going Out: Ensure your iPhone is fully charged and stored in an insulated case. Disable background app refresh to conserve energy.
  2. During Outdoor Activity: Keep the phone in an inner pocket. Use gloves with conductive fingertips only when necessary to reduce screen-on time.
  3. If Performance Drops: If the screen lags or battery drains abnormally, power off the device and warm it against your body. Do not force operation.
  4. Upon Returning Indoors: Place the phone in a sealed plastic bag before entering heated spaces. This traps external air and prevents condensation as it warms.
  5. After Warming: Wait at least 45 minutes before turning it back on or charging. Check for moisture indicators (located near the SIM tray) if concerned about water ingress.

Frequently Asked Questions

Can cold weather permanently damage my iPhone 15 Pro Max?

Yes. Repeated exposure to temperatures below -10°C can cause permanent battery capacity loss, screen delamination, or internal condensation leading to corrosion. While one-off incidents may only cause temporary glitches, chronic cold exposure accelerates hardware aging.

Why does my iPhone shut down suddenly in the cold?

Lithium-ion batteries temporarily lose voltage output in cold conditions. The phone interprets this as critically low charge and shuts down to protect circuits. Once warmed, the device often powers back on with significant battery remaining.

Is the iPhone 15 Pro Max more resistant to cold than older models?

Slightly. Thanks to improved battery chemistry and better sealing (IP68 rating), it handles brief cold exposure better than predecessors. However, core vulnerabilities remain unchanged. No iPhone is designed for sustained operation in freezing environments.

Essential Winter iPhone Care Checklist

  • ✅ Invest in a rugged, insulated case
  • ✅ Keep the phone close to your body in cold weather
  • ✅ Pre-download maps and content before going outside
  • ✅ Enable Low Power Mode when outdoors
  • ✅ Carry a warmed power bank for emergencies
  • ✅ Seal phone in a plastic bag before bringing indoors
  • ✅ Wait 30–60 minutes before charging after cold exposure
  • ✅ Monitor battery health monthly via Settings > Battery
